Here is short description of Independent Living Housing: Independent Living Housing (ILH) was formed in 1998 as a non-profit community-based organization. Our mission is to provide independent living programs for teens and young adults who have learning disabilities and who are members of low to moderate income households. ILH serves people between the ages of three through twenty-six years. Our vision is to create an environment where the learning disabled can meet their maximum potential and become productive citizens. ILH is committed to helping the individual succeed by offering learning disabled and developmentally delayed individuals rewarding programs. The programs also serve as an alternative to drugs, alcohol and tobacco use; criminal activity; and other high-risk behaviors. We value your input!
